Tonewise is a chromatic instrument tuner, metronome and drone. It is designed to be private by default. This policy explains what the app does — and does not do — with your data.
None. Tonewise does not collect, transmit, sell, or share any personal data. The app works fully offline and requires no account.
Tonewise uses the microphone only to detect the pitch of your instrument in real time, on your device. The audio is analysed live and is never recorded, stored, or sent anywhere. Microphone access is requested the first time you open the tuner and can be revoked any time in iOS Settings.
The app stores your preferences (instrument, tuning, reference pitch, metronome and drone settings) and a local practice log on your device only, using Apple's standard local storage. This never leaves your device and is removed when you delete the app. You can clear your practice log any time.
There are no third-party SDKs, analytics, advertising, or tracking technologies in this app.
Tonewise does not knowingly collect any data from anyone, including children.
